Air Resource Warm Pumps vs. Geothermal Heat Pumps



When thinking about Air Source Warmth Pumps vs. Geothermal Warmth Pumps for your home, there are key distinctions to remember.

Air Resource Heat Pumps essence warm from the outside air and are a lot more typical due to lower installation costs. They function well in modest environments however might be less reliable in extreme cold.

Geothermal Heat Pumps, on the other hand, utilize warm from the ground, offering regular heating and cooling down regardless of external temperatures. While they have actually higher upfront expenses, they're more energy-efficient over time and have a longer life expectancy.

Air Source Warmth Pumps are simpler to set up and preserve compared to Geothermal Heat Pumps, which call for more intricate underground setups. Nevertheless, Geothermal Warm Pumps deal higher power financial savings in time, making them a more eco-friendly alternative.



Consider your environment, spending plan, and long-lasting goals when picking in between these two types of heat pumps for your home.
